NCDC Confirms 386 New Cases Of Coronavirus In Nigeria
The Nigerian Centre for Disease Control (NCDC) on Friday confirmed 386 new cases of coronavirus in Nigeria. This brings the total number of cases in the country to 3912.
According to the breakdown by NCDC according to the states, 176-Lagos 65-Kano 31-Katsina 20-FCT 17-Borno 15-Bauchi 14-Nasarawa 13-Ogun 10-Plateau 4-Oyo 4-Sokoto 4-Rivers 3-Kaduna 2-Edo 2-Ebonyi 2-Ondo 1-Enugu 1-Imo 1-Gombe 1-Osun
Nnamdi Kanu Lists 3 Prominent Nigerians That Must Be Released From Jail After Orji Kalu’s Freedom
The leader of the Indigenous People of Biafra (IPOB), Nnamdi Kanu has listed three prominent Nigerians that must be released from jail after the Supreme Court judgment on Orji Uzor Kalu, a former governor of Abia State, southeastern Nigeria.
Naija News reports that the Supreme Court on Friday nullified the conviction of the former governor of Abia State. Kalu was sentenced to 12 years in prison over N7.16 billion fraud by a Federal High Court sitting in Lagos, on December 5.

EFCC To Re-Arraign Orji Kalu Again, After Supreme Court Nullifies Former Ruling
Earlier it was reported that the Supreme Court had nullified the conviction of a former governor of Abia State, Orji Uzor Kalu.
The court further nullified the judgement against his firm, Slok Nigeria Limited and Jones Udeogu, a former Director of Finance and Account of Abia State Government.
Covid-19: Edo State Shut Down Popular Place, Lagos Street
The immediate closure of a popular place in Edo state, Lagos Street, an epicenter of trade and commerce in Benin, has been ordered by the Edo State Government to check the spread of coronavirus (COVID-19) in the state.
This was announced by the special Adviser to the Governor on Media and Communication Strategy, Mr. Crusoe Osagie.
